How to convert Flash to iPod


This guide will show you how to convert Flash video to iPod with Flash to iPod Converter.

Firstly, download, install and run Flash to iPod Converter

Flash to iPod Converter

Step 1: Import Flash File
There are two methods to to add Flash files from your hard disc:
1). Click the "Import" button.
2). Click the Import button next to the "Import" button and choose Add Files:

Import Flash File

Step 2: Edit File

Click the "Edit" icon on the main interface to edit the selected file.

Edit File

Crop: You can select an area from the video by dragging the crop frame. As you drag the crop frame, the X value, the Y value, the width and the height can be viewed in the "Cropped Area" pane. If you want to redo the selection, you can click the Full Area button.
Switch file: Under the crop screen, you can click the two arrow buttons to navigate through all the added files.
Add Watermark: The program allows you to add a watermark to your video. Check the Add Watermark option and select a picture from your hard disc as the watermark of the current file. The opacity of the added watermark can be adjusted by dragging the Opacity adjustment bar.

Step 3: Settings

Click the "Settings" button to set the output setttings for the selected file.

Settings

Output Format: Select an output format for the selected file.
Video:
Encoder: Select a video encoder for the video conversion.
Resolution: Choose the appropriate resolution for the final video.
Frame Rate: Choose a frame rate for the final video. The program allows you to choose to keep the original frame rate.
Bit rate: Choose a bit rate for the final video. Bit rate is the amount of data being decoded per second.
Aspect Ratio: Choose an aspect ratio for the final video The program also allows you to choose to keep the original aspect ratio or fill the full screen.
Audio:
Encoder: Select an audio encoder for the audio conversion.
Sample Rate: Choose an appropriate sample rate for the final audio.
Channel: Choose an audio channel for the final audio.
Bit rate: Choose a bit rate for the final audio.

Step 4: Convert Movie

Click the "Convert" icon to start the conversion:

Convert

Output Folder: Set the output folder by specifying a folder on your hard disc to save the converted files.
Shut down computer when conversion completed: Check this option if you want to shut down your computer right after the conversion. This option is useful when you have to be away from your computer for some time.
Open folder when conversion completed: Check this option if you want to open the folder (output folder) where the converted files are saved right after the conversion.

After you finish the above settings, click "Start" to start the conversion. Then you can just wait till the conversion is finished. The elapsed time and remaining time of the conversion can be found under the process bars for your reference.
